Getting to the decision of which legal entity to choose, let's take each one separately. The most common form of legal entity is the business. There are two basic forms, C Corp and S Corp. A C Corp pays tax according to its profit for 4 seasons and then any dividends paid to shareholders is also taxed. Hence the term double-taxation. An S Corp however works differently. The S Corp pays no tax on profits. The profit flows through to the shareholders who then pay tax on cash. The big difference totally free that the 15.3% self-employment tax doesn't apply.
